+void BezierViewer::paintEvent( QPaintEvent* )
+{
+    if ( points.size() != 4 ) {
+#if defined(QT_CHECK_RANGE)
+	qWarning( "QPolygon::bezier: The array must have 4 control points" );
+#endif
+	return;
+    }
+
+    // Calculate Bezier curve
+    QPolygonF bezier = QBezier::fromPoints(points.at(0),points.at(1),points.at(2),points.at(3)).toPolygon();
+
+    QPainter painter( this );
+
+    // Calculate scale to fit in window
+    QRectF br = bezier.boundingRect() | points.boundingRect();
+    QRectF pr = rect();
+    int scl = qMax( qMin(pr.width()/br.width(), pr.height()/br.height()), qreal(1.) );
+    int border = scl-1;
+
+    // Scale Bezier curve vertices
+    for ( QPolygonF::Iterator it = bezier.begin(); it != bezier.end(); ++it ) {
+	it->setX( (it->x()-br.x()) * scl + border );
+	it->setY( (it->y()-br.y()) * scl + border );
+    }
+
+    // Draw grid
+    painter.setPen( Qt::lightGray );
+	int i;
+	for ( i = border; i <= pr.width(); i += scl ) {
+		painter.drawLine( i, 0, i, pr.height() );
+    }
+    for ( int j = border; j <= pr.height(); j += scl ) {
+	painter.drawLine( 0, j, pr.width(), j );
+    }
+
+    // Write number of vertices
+    painter.setPen( Qt::red );
+    painter.setFont( QFont("Helvetica", 14, QFont::DemiBold, TRUE ) );
+    QString caption;
+    caption.setNum( bezier.size() );
+    caption += QString::fromLatin1( " vertices" );
+    painter.drawText( 10, pr.height()-10, caption );
+
+    // Draw Bezier curve
+    painter.setPen( Qt::black );
+    painter.drawPolyline( bezier );
+
+    // Scale and draw control points
+    painter.setPen( Qt::darkGreen );
+    for ( QPolygonF::Iterator p1 = points.begin(); p1 != points.end(); ++p1 ) {
+	int x = (p1->x()-br.x()) * scl + border;
+	int y = (p1->y()-br.y()) * scl + border;
+	painter.drawLine( x-4, y-4, x+4, y+4 );
+	painter.drawLine( x+4, y-4, x-4, y+4 );
+    }
+
+    // Draw vertices
+    painter.setPen( Qt::red );
+    painter.setBrush( Qt::red );
+    for ( QPolygonF::Iterator p2 = bezier.begin(); p2 != bezier.end(); ++p2 )
+	painter.drawEllipse( p2->x()-1, p2->y()-1, 3, 3 );
+}

+void tst_QWidget::showFullScreen()
+{
+    QWidget plain;
+    QHBoxLayout *layout;
+    QWidget layouted;
+    QLineEdit le;
+    QLineEdit le2;
+    QLineEdit le3;
+    layout = new QHBoxLayout;
+
+    layout->addWidget(&le);
+    layout->addWidget(&le2);
+    layout->addWidget(&le3);
+
+    layouted.setLayout(layout);
+
+    plain.showFullScreen();
+    QVERIFY(plain.windowState() & Qt::WindowFullScreen);
+
+    plain.showNormal();
+    QVERIFY(!(plain.windowState() & Qt::WindowFullScreen));
+
+    layouted.showFullScreen();
+    QVERIFY(layouted.windowState() & Qt::WindowFullScreen);
+
+    layouted.showNormal();
+    QVERIFY(!(layouted.windowState() & Qt::WindowFullScreen));
+
+#if !defined(Q_WS_QWS) && !defined(Q_OS_WINCE) && !defined (Q_WS_S60)
+//embedded may choose a different size to fit on the screen.
+    QCOMPARE(layouted.size(), layouted.sizeHint());
+#endif
+
+    layouted.showFullScreen();
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isFullScreen());
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isVisible());
+
+    layouted.hide();
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isFullScreen());
+    QVERIFY(!layouted.isVisible());
+
+    layouted.showFullScreen();
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isFullScreen());
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isVisible());
+
+    layouted.showMinimized();
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isMinimized());
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isFullScreen());
+
+    layouted.showFullScreen();
+    QVERIFY(!layouted.isMinimized());
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isFullScreen());
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isVisible());
+
+    layouted.showMinimized();
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isMinimized());
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isFullScreen());
+
+    layouted.showFullScreen();
+    QVERIFY(!layouted.isMinimized());
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isFullScreen());
+    QVERIFY(layouted.isVisible());
+
+    {
+        QWidget frame;
+        QWidget widget(&frame);
+        widget.showFullScreen();
+        QVERIFY(widget.isFullScreen());
+    }
+
+#ifdef QT3_SUPPORT
+#if !defined(Q_WS_QWS)
+//embedded respects max/min sizes by design -- maybe wrong design, but that's the way it is now.
+    {
+        Q3HBox box;
+        QWidget widget(&box);
+        widget.setMinimumSize(500, 500);
+        box.showFullScreen();
+        QVERIFY(box.isFullScreen());
+    }
+
+    {
+        Q3HBox box;
+        QWidget widget(&box);
+        widget.setMaximumSize(500, 500);
+
+        box.showFullScreen();
+        QVERIFY(box.isFullScreen());
+    }
+#endif
+#endif // QT3_SUPPORT
+}
